The Professional Certificate in Museum Community Relations is a comprehensive course designed to bridge the gap between museums and the communities they serve. This course emphasizes the importance of community engagement, cultural sensitivity, and effective communication in the museum industry.

With the increasing demand for museums to be more inclusive and accessible, this course offers essential skills for career advancement in this field. By enrolling in this certificate course, learners will gain a deep understanding of community relations best practices, develop strategies for engaging diverse audiences, and learn how to create inclusive museum environments. The curriculum includes practical applications, case studies, and real-world examples to ensure learners are well-equipped to make a positive impact in their museum careers. In summary, this Professional Certificate in Museum Community Relations course is critical for those looking to excel in the museum industry, as it provides the skills and knowledge necessary to build strong community relationships, foster inclusivity, and drive museum growth and success in the 21st century.

Detalles del Curso

โ€ข Understanding Museums and Community
โ€ข Community Engagement Strategies in Museums
โ€ข Best Practices for Museum-Community Partnerships
โ€ข Diversity, Equity, and Inclusion in Museum Community Relations
โ€ข Museum Community Relations Program Planning and Evaluation
โ€ข Effective Communication with Community Stakeholders
โ€ข Museum Outreach and Event Management
โ€ข Museum Community Relations Case Studies
โ€ข Legal and Ethical Considerations in Museum Community Relations
